Clerk-Treasurer Tina Davidson told the council she is working on the payroll budget and will present it at the next meeting when Dwayne is present. The Planning Commission announced a Sept. 25 meeting to consider a Conditional Use Permit. These procedural items were presented without debate.
In council communications, Mayor Pro-Tem Lori Loseth said she will attend the MPO meeting for the mayor due to his work schedule. Council member Craig Stein raised a question about responsibility for a trip on a sidewalk in the Appleford addition; Clerk Davidson said the homeowner is responsible and that she will investigate and report back. No formal direction or votes were taken on these items during the Sept. 8 meeting.
